原文链接:http://www.ithome.com/html/soft/57033.htm

ArcThemALL!软件主要功能:

1、支持压缩和解压功能,支持常用的7z、zip、cab、iso、rar等常见的压缩格式。支持将多个压缩文件拖拽到软件界面,就可以用ArcThemALL!完成批量解压缩操作。

操作步骤:添加压缩文件或者拖拽进去,选择软件主界面的向上箭头标识的“Extraction”按钮后,接着把左下角的下拉菜单从“UPX”改成“Archives”,点击start按钮就可以。

如果要进行批量压缩操作,那么你必须添加文件夹而不是文件。

操作步骤:添加多个文件夹,选择向下标识的“compress”按钮,左下角下拉菜单改成“zip”或者“7z”,最后点击start。

2、脱壳:即解开例如exe、dll、MSI这类常用的安装程序包。其他也支持APM, ARJ, BZIP2, CHM, CPIO, DEB, DMG, FAT, GZIP, HFS, LZH, LZMA, LZMA2, MBR, MSLZ, NSIS, NTFS, RPM, SFX, TAR, UDF, VHD, WIM, XAR, XZ, Z等格式的文件。

这样提取安装程序目录,一些Dll动态文件,甚至也可以提取新的Icons。

操作步骤:添加需要脱壳的exe、dll或者其他文件,选择软件主界面的向上箭头标识的“Extraction”按钮后,接着把左下角的下拉菜单从“UPX”改成“Archives”,点击start就可以了。(但是对于加密的exe程序,该软件还是束手无策)

3、使用UPX功能,可以减小exe程序的体积

操作:选择“compress”,添加exe程序,在左下角菜单选择“upx”,点击start,这样就可以看到那个添加的可执行文件减少了非常多的体积。

ArcThemALL! 5.1更新日记:

• 新增支持生成一个Log文件

• 更新内置UPX组件到v3.91

• 修复在软件主体界面菜单和发送到右键菜单中问题

• 修复一些已知的问题

ArcThemALL! 5.1官方下载:英语版

支持Windows XP、VistaWin7Win8Win8.1等平台

安装版,1.7MB:

便携版,1.5MB:

ArcThemALL!5.1:解压、脱壳、压缩样样精通的更多相关文章

  1. linux中tar之解压和压缩常用

    我们知道在windows中解压和压缩有两个非常强大的工具winRar和国产的好压工具,在linux中也有一款强大的解压和压缩工具.那就是大名鼎鼎的tar.我们首先看看tar命令的使用格式 语法:tar ...

  2. Linux:文件解压与压缩

    文件打包与压缩 常见压缩文件格式: |文件后缀名 |说明| |.zip |zip程序打包压缩的文件| |.rar |rar程序压缩的文件| |.7z |7zip程序压缩的文件| |.tar |tar程 ...

  3. asp.net实现文件解压和压缩

    C#解压RAR压缩文件(--转载--测试通过) using System; using System.Collections.Generic; using System.Text; using Sys ...

  4. [转]Ubuntu Linux 安装 .7z 解压和压缩文件

    [转]Ubuntu Linux 安装 .7z 解压和压缩文件 http://blog.csdn.net/zqlovlg/article/details/8033456 安装方法: sudo apt-g ...

  5. [转]Ubuntu 常用解压与压缩命令

    .tar 文件(注:tar是打包,不是压缩!) # 仅打包,并非压缩 tar -xvf FileName.tar # 解包 tar -cvf FileName.tar DirName # 将DirNa ...

  6. os与操作系统进行交互,sys解释器相关,random随机数,shutil解压和压缩

    1.os 与操作系统相关 对文件的处理 对路径的处理 import os#主要用于与操作系统进行交互 掌握: print(os.makedirs('a/b/c'))#创建目录 可用递归创建 print ...

  7. Mac上zip,rar,tar文件命令解压和压缩

    经常遇到在windowns上的压缩文件,在mac上解压出现问题,特意总结了下在Terminal里常用命令的方式解压和压缩文件 1.zip压缩文件 zip命令的参数很多,可以利用"zip -- ...

  8. 【Linux】war包的解压与压缩

    现在存在一个war包test.war(以下是在Linux上操作) 1.解压war包 jar –xvf test.war 说明:直接解压到当前文件夹,如果需要解压到指定的文件夹下,需要将test.war ...

  9. linux包安装,解压,压缩,包管理,环境变量

    linux 包安装,解压,压缩,包管理 centoscentos上有系统包管理器yum yum的配置一般有两种方式,一种是直接配置/etc目录下的yum.conf文件,另外一种是在/etc/yum.r ...

  10. linux 中解压与压缩 常用操作详细讲解

    平时有时候 会在服务器进行一些文件的操作,比如安装一些服务与软件等等,都有解压操作,一般在 导出一些简单的服务器文件,也是先压缩后再导出,因此,在这里根据平时用到解压与压缩命令的频率来记录下: 1.最 ...

随机推荐

  1. ubuntu常用技巧积累

    1.修改root密码,一般与用户密码不同 python@ubuntu:~$ sudo passwd[sudo] password for python: 输入新的 UNIX 密码: 重新输入新的 UN ...

  2. HDU 3642 - Get The Treasury - [加强版扫描线+线段树]

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=3642 Time Limit: 10000/5000 MS (Java/Others) Memory L ...

  3. redis系列之数据库与缓存数据一致性解决方案

    redis系列之数据库与缓存数据一致性解决方案 数据库与缓存读写模式策略 写完数据库后是否需要马上更新缓存还是直接删除缓存? (1).如果写数据库的值与更新到缓存值是一样的,不需要经过任何的计算,可以 ...

  4. svn冲突的解决

    svn文件冲突的解决 冲突后,会产生三个多余的文件. ①文件名.扩展名.mine 这是你的文件,在你更新你的工作副本之前存在于你的工作副本中--也就是说,没有冲突标志.这个文件 除了你的最新修改外没有 ...

  5. mysql python pymysql模块 增删改查 插入数据 介绍 commit() execute() executemany() 函数

    import pymysql mysql_host = '192.168.0.106' port = 3306 mysql_user = 'root' mysql_pwd = ' encoding = ...

  6. mysql 使用存储引擎

    三 使用存储引擎 方法1:建表时指定引擎 指定innodb,不写默认也是innodb use 数据库先 create table innodb_t1(id int,name char)engine=i ...

  7. 模仿linux内核定时器代码,用python语言实现定时器

    大学无聊的时候看过linux内核的定时器,如今已经想不起来了,也不知道当时有没有看懂,如今想要模仿linux内核的定时器.用python写一个定时器,已经想不起来它的设计原理了.找了一篇blog,li ...

  8. Locust性能测试3-no-web模式和csv报告保存

    前言 前面是在web页面操作,需要手动的点start启动,结束的时候也需要手工去点stop,没法自定义运行时间,这就不太方便. locust提供了命令行运行的方法,不启动web页面也能运行,这就是no ...

  9. java多态性方法的重写Overriding和重载Overloading详解

    java多态性方法的重写Overriding和重载Overloading详解 方法的重写Overriding和重载Overloading是Java多态性的不同表现.重写Overriding是父类与子类 ...

  10. jquery 的each函数

    each函数经常用到.它本身就是一个循环遍历 你可以可以break continue 但这是在for while循环中 each中我们可以这样 下面的例子是遍历 MyTable中所有的tr 第一个td ...